Output 23f14eef3425a52093557ef033e1055834a0b49d9a712cb84f7d7c6206d8c3f5:54

value
44975
script pubkey
OP_0 OP_PUSHBYTES_32 34300817d0249cf84dba2b116b3c9adcc0d61355eb6a9087050eb96803227d01
address
bc1qxscqs97syjw0snd69vgkk0y6mnqdvy64ad4fppc9p6uksqez05qsdtjy76
transaction
23f14eef3425a52093557ef033e1055834a0b49d9a712cb84f7d7c6206d8c3f5
spent
true